fix:修复鼠标拖拽位置偏移问题

main
zhu.yawen 1 year ago
parent 0ac94c72fb
commit 77d639ab62

@ -87,10 +87,10 @@ export default {
} }
this.isSelectDown = true this.isSelectDown = true
this.startX = (event.x - this.offsetX) / this.scale this.startX = (event.x - this.offsetX) / this.scale + 50
this.startY = (event.y - this.offsetY) / this.scale this.startY = (event.y - this.offsetY) / this.scale + 50
this.endX = (event.x - this.offsetX) / this.scale this.endX = (event.x - this.offsetX) / this.scale + 50
this.endY = (event.y - this.offsetY) / this.scale this.endY = (event.y - this.offsetY) / this.scale + 50
} }
}, },
handleMouseMove (event) { handleMouseMove (event) {
@ -102,8 +102,8 @@ export default {
this.isSelecting = true this.isSelecting = true
} }
if (this.isSelecting) { if (this.isSelecting) {
this.endX = (event.x - this.offsetX) / this.scale this.endX = (event.x - this.offsetX) / this.scale + 50
this.endY = (event.y - this.offsetY) / this.scale this.endY = (event.y - this.offsetY) / this.scale + 50
} }
}, },
handleMouseUp (event) { handleMouseUp (event) {

Loading…
Cancel
Save